Our toroidal transformers offer distinct advantages over traditional laminated or R-core types, especially for sensitive medical electronics. The key features and client benefits include:
- Superior Electrical Performance: The toroidal core design inherently provides lower stray magnetic fields, reduced audible noise, and higher efficiency. This results in cleaner power delivery, which is crucial for the stable operation of diagnostic and therapeutic devices.
- Enhanced Safety by Design: We prioritize safety features that exceed standard requirements for medical applications. This includes implementing reinforced insulation, specifying materials with high dielectric strength, and designing for very low leakage current to protect both the device and the patient.
- Compact and Space-Efficient: Toroidal transformers have a higher power-to-volume ratio. This allows for more compact medical device designs, giving our clients greater flexibility in their product form factors without compromising on power capacity.
- Customization as Standard: Every transformer is tailored. We work with your specifications for input/output voltages, current ratings, physical dimensions, mounting styles, and lead configurations to ensure a perfect fit for your specific medical power supply unit.
To illustrate the typical technical scope, here are some common specification parameters we customize:
| Parameter | Typical Customization Range / Options |
| Input Voltage (Vin) | 100V, 110V, 120V, 220V, 230V, 240V (50/60Hz) |
| Output Configuration | Single or Multiple Secondaries; Center-Tapped |
| Rated Power (VA) | From 10VA to 1000VA+ (Custom) |
| Regulation | Typically <5% to <10% (Load Dependent) |
| Isolation Voltage | Enhanced levels (e.g., 4000VAC) for patient safety |
| Leakage Current | Designed to meet stringent medical limits (<100µA) |
| Operating Temperature | -20°C to +Class Rating (e.g., Class B: +130°C) |
| Encapsulation / Shielding | Optional: Vacuum impregnation, epoxy potting, electrostatic shield |

Q: What makes a toroidal transformer suitable for medical devices compared to other types?
A: Toroidal transformers are preferred for medical applications due to their inherently low electromagnetic interference (EMI), which helps devices meet strict EMC regulations. Their compact size, high efficiency, and low audible noise also make them ideal for sensitive and space-constrained medical equipment. -
Q: Can you customize the transformer to meet specific medical safety standards like IEC 60601-1?
A: Yes, absolutely. Our design and manufacturing process focuses on enhanced safety standards. We can tailor key parameters such as creepage/clearance distances, insulation materials, and isolation voltage to help your power supply comply with relevant medical safety standards. Q: Do you offer any protective treatments for the transformer?
A: Yes, we offer optional protective treatments such as vacuum impregnation with varnish to protect against moisture and vibration, or full epoxy potting for extreme environmental sealing and additional mechanical strength. An electrostatic shield between windings is also available to further reduce noise. -
Q: How do you ensure quality and consistency in production?
A: Our production is governed by an ISO9001 quality management system. We implement rigorous testing at multiple stages, including raw material inspection, in-process checks, and final performance tests (e.g., turns ratio, insulation resistance, hi-pot, load regulation). -

Q: What are the key advantages of your toroidal transformers in terms of electrical performance?
A: The core advantages include higher efficiency (less heat generation), better voltage regulation under load, lower magnetic stray field (reducing interference with nearby circuits), and significantly lower mechanical hum, which is critical for quiet medical environments.
